Description

The Devon & Somerset Standing List of Approved Contractors (the SLoAC) is to be used by the Authority staff to select contractors for Maintenance, Improvement and Building Works up to £2,000,000 per project (the majority of works will be in the range of £5,000 and £250,000) and for works below £5,000. Where the SLoAC has insufficient numbers of Contractors the Authority is at liberty to use alternative procurement methods. The Authority's estate comprises approximately 600 establishments including some 200+ schools, together with other educational units, Children's Centres, Social Care Units, other corporate buildings and some tenanted farms. Please note the Authority has a property rationalisation strategy in operation, whereby the number of its premises is likely to change/ reduce over time. Devon has been subdivided into 10 geographical areas and Somerset 5 geographical areas for the purposes of this arrangement. Contractors may, subject to qualification, elect to operate in any number of these geographical areas. A map of the Devon & Somerset Sub Areas is provided in section A5 of this application pack.
